CVE-2026-44752

SAP NetWeaver Application Server Java(CoVulnerabilityCVSS 8.2

SAP NetWeaver Application Server Java allows an unauthenticated attacker to inject malicious JavaScript through crafted URLs. When a victim accesses such a URL, the script executes in the user's browser, allowing the attacker to access sensitive session information and modify non-sensitive data displayed in the client�s browser. This results in a high impact on confidentiality, low impact on integrity with no impact on availability of the application.

No public exploitation has been reported so far. No distribution fix is listed yet; apply vendor mitigations and monitor.

Severity metrics

CVSS 3.1 : 8.2 HIGH

Attack vectorNetwork (remote)
Attack complexityLow
Privileges requiredNone
User interactionRequired
ScopeChanged
Confidentiality impactHigh
Integrity impactLow
Availability impactNone

Vector: A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:C/C:H/I:L/A:N
